U.S. tariff policy is reshaping market dynamics once again. The administration's latest stance frames tariffs not just as revenue generators but as strategic national security instruments. Claims of "great wealth creation" and inflation-neutral impacts are gaining traction in policy circles—yet crypto markets remain sensitive to such macro signals. Historically, tariff escalations introduce volatility across asset classes. For traders monitoring macro trends, this policy direction matters: inflationary pressures, currency movements, and capital flows all cascade into digital asset valuations. Whether tariffs truly deliver wealth without inflation consequences will be a key datapoint for the broader Web3 ecosystem watching Fed policy and global economic positioning.
